Subject: [PATCH obexd 07/10] client: Use filter instead of dummy as argument name in MAP
Date: Wed, 27 Jun 2012 15:04:52 +0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1340798695-6785-7-git-send-email-luiz.dentz@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1340798695-6785-1-git-send-email-luiz.dentz@gmail.com>

From: Luiz Augusto von Dentz <luiz.von.dentz@intel.com>

This is aligned with the documentation that uses filter as well.
---
 client/map.c |    4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/client/map.c b/client/map.c
index 2fc9b23..b8c0cb8 100644
--- a/client/map.c
+++ b/client/map.c
@@ -383,11 +383,11 @@ static const GDBusMethodTable map_methods[] = {
 				GDBUS_ARGS({ "name", "s" }), NULL,
 				map_setpath) },
 	{ GDBUS_ASYNC_METHOD("GetFolderListing",
-					GDBUS_ARGS({ "dummy", "a{ss}" }),
+					GDBUS_ARGS({ "filter", "a{ss}" }),
 					GDBUS_ARGS({ "content", "aa{sv}" }),
 					map_get_folder_listing) },
 	{ GDBUS_ASYNC_METHOD("GetMessageListing",
-			GDBUS_ARGS({ "folder", "s" }, { "dummy", "a{ss}" }),
+			GDBUS_ARGS({ "folder", "s" }, { "filter", "a{ss}" }),
 			GDBUS_ARGS({ "messages", "aa{sv}" }),
 			map_get_message_listing) },
 	{ }
